Powered by Blogger.
Showing posts with label Dodge SRT. Show all posts
Showing posts with label Dodge SRT. Show all posts

2014 Dodge SRT Viper TA

thumbnail
Since its arrival in 1991, the Dodger Viper has been a stateside supercar that just doesn’t get its due. From the RT/10 all the way to the ...